Research Progress on Main Parasitic Pathogens Causing Lamb Diarrhea
Lamb diarrhea is a common and frequently occurring disease in sheep,mainly characterized by diarrhea and dysentery,which leads to slow growth and even death of lambs.The factors causing diarrhea of lambs are relatively complex.Apart from feeding and management factors,pathogenic infection is an important factor causing diarrhea of lambs.Co-infection of diarrhea-associated infectious agents is common and poses a challenge to field investigation of diarrheal sheep.In this paper,the common parasitic pathogens causing lamb diarrhea were reviewed,aiming to provide reference for the surveillance of lamb diarrheal disease,the formulation of immunization plan and the prevention and control of the disease in the future.
